What school district is Franklin Elementary School in?

Franklin Elementary School is part of the Mattoon CUSD 2 district in Mattoon, Illinois.

Is Franklin Elementary School a good school?

Franklin Elementary School does not have enough recent test data for a SchoolRow ranking.

What is the racial makeup of Franklin Elementary School?

White 77%, Black 11%, Two or more races 7%, Hispanic 4% (217 students, 2023–24).

How much do homes near Franklin Elementary School cost?

The typical home value in zip code 61938 is $127K as of 2026-05 (Zillow ZHVI).
